A free speaker series sponsored by: Bloomsburg University, The University of Scranton, and Wilkes University. Featured Speaker: Kitty Caparella Crime Reporter, Philadelphia Daily and a 1984 Pulitzer prize finalist for a series about drugs in Philadelphia. Kitty has spent 37 years at Philadelphia Daily News where she covers crime and the mafia. She has written about public corruption and extremist groups including a back to nature cult, outlaw bikers, white supremacists, violent drug traffickers and radical Muslims. She also is a well-known Philadelphia artist. Before authorities led away a drug trafficker in federal court, he told her: ¡°Kitty, I knew when you started writing me up, I was done.¡±
